Heavy rains trigger landslides and flash floods across Hazara division, several villages cut off

ABBOTTABAD, (UrduPoint / Pakistan Point News - 4th Apr, 2026) Torrential rains continued to wreak havoc across the Hazara division, with a major landslide in the Kewai Damgarian area of Mansehra blocking a key road and disrupting traffic flow. Rescue 1122 Mansehra teams, along with police and local residents, launched relief operations.

The debris removal process was initiated promptly, and through joint efforts, the road was cleared and traffic was restored. Fortunately, no loss of life has been reported in this incident.

However, the situation remains critical in other parts of the division.

According to reports, continuous heavy downpours have triggered flash floods and multiple landslides in remote village areas across Hazara, leaving several settlements completely disconnected from nearby cities. Land routes have been severed, and residents in these cut-off areas face limited access to essential supplies and emergency services.

Rescue 1122 Mansehra teams remain on 24/7 alert to handle all types of emergencies. Citizens are urged to exercise extreme caution when traveling through hilly and sensitive areas during rainfall. In case of any emergency, call 1122 immediately.
